What does a Regional Senior Director Commercial Finance do at Hogarth
The Regional Senior Director Commercial Finance is a critical leadership role responsible for overseeing and optimizing all client financial operations across the organizations regional footprint. Reporting to the CFO Americas this individual will serve as a strategic business partner to senior leadership driving revenue growth ensuring profitability and maintaining financial integrity across all client engagements. The Regional Senior Director will lead a team of finance professionals providing mentorship guidance and development opportunities to foster a highperforming and collaborative environment. This role requires a deep understanding of the client services industry exceptional financial acumen strong leadership skills excellent collaboration skills with internal partners and the ability to influence and collaborate effectively with stakeholders at all levels.

Responsibilities:
Strategic Planning & Execution:
- Develop and implement a comprehensive commercial finance strategy across North America that aligns with the organizations overall business objectives and drives revenue growth.
- Lead the development of financial models and analyses to support strategic initiatives such as new market entry service expansion and pricing optimization.
- Monitor and analyze key performance indicators (KPIs) to track progress against strategic goals and identify areas for improvement.
Client Financial Management:
- Oversee the development and management of client budgets forecasts and financial reports ensuring accuracy and timeliness.
- Partner with account teams and clients to develop and review Statements of Work (SOWs) and construct competitive and profitable fee structures.
- Ensure all stakeholders adhere to documented processes for work development bidding estimating fee approval billing and reconciliation.
- Develop and maintain rate cards for US and Canada that reflect industry standards agency protocols and market conditions ensuring consistency and transparency.
- Review and analyze data including staff utilization revenue forecasts and actuals to ensure profitability and identify opportunities for cost optimization.
- Oversee the billing process to ensure timely and accurate invoicing resolving any discrepancies or issues promptly.
